Volume 7, Book 62, Number 136:
Narrated Jabir:
We used to practice coitus interrupt us while the Quran was being revealed. Jabir added: We used
to practice coitus interrupt us during the lifetime of Allah’s Apostle while the Quran was being Re –
vealed.
Volume 7, Book 62, Number 121:
Narrated Abu Huraira:
The Prophet said, “If a man Invites his wife to sleep with him and she refuses to come to him, then
the angels send their curses on her till morning.”
Volume 7, Book 62, Number 137:
Narrated Abu Said Al-Khudri:
We got female captives in the war booty and we used to do coitus interruptus with them. So we
asked Allah’s Apostle about it and he said, “Do you really do that?” repeating the question thrice,
“There is no soul that is destined to exist but will come into existence, till the Day of Resurrection.”
Volume 7, Book 62, Number 122:
Narrated Abu Huraira:
The Prophet said, “If a woman spends the night deserting her husband’s bed (does not sleep with
him), then the angels send their curses on her till she comes back (to her husband).”

Volume 7, Book 62, Number 107:
Narrated Abu Huraira:
The Prophet said, “If I am invited to a meal of trotters I will accept it; and if I am given a trotter as
a present I will accept it.”
Volume 7, Book 62, Number 108:
Narrated Nafi’:
Abdullah bin ‘Umar said, “Allah’s Apostle said, ‘Accept the marriage invitation if you are invited to
it.’ ” Ibn ‘Umar used to accept the invitation whether to a wedding banquet or to any other party,
even when he was fasting.
Volume 7, Book 62, Number 109:
Narrated Anas bin Malik:
Once the Prophet saw some women and children coming from a wedding party. He got up ener –
getically and happily and said, “By Allah! You (i.e., the Ansar) are the most beloved of all people to
me.”
